Output fbbd05406ac50ebaaaa68e776552ab94cee995e5c066ba68727a27a44eb73fe1:1

value
1515903
script pubkey
OP_0 OP_PUSHBYTES_20 d21da2b70af70f89a6a377e56d9b0b083f48ddf2
address
bc1q6gw69dc27u8cnf4rwljkmxctpql53h0jmnlsqm
transaction
fbbd05406ac50ebaaaa68e776552ab94cee995e5c066ba68727a27a44eb73fe1
spent
true